Cisco QSFP‑4SFP25G‑CU3M Full English Product Description
Product Overview
Cisco QSFP‑4SFP25G‑CU3M is an original Cisco passive breakout twinax copper direct‑attach cable with a fixed length of 3 meters. One end terminates with a QSFP28 connector, and the fan‑out side provides four independent SFP28 connectors. Compliant with QSFP28 MSA SFF‑8665, SFP28 MSA SFF‑8402 and IEEE 802.3bj standards, it delivers cost‑effective zero‑power interconnection solution for short‑to‑medium‑range intra‑rack and adjacent cross‑rack links in enterprise, cloud, AI and high‑performance computing data centers, converting one 100G QSFP28 port into four separate 25G SFP28 ports.
Key Features
-
100G Aggregated / 4×25G Full‑Duplex Electrical Transmission
Supports 100GBASE‑CR4 aggregated bandwidth, breaking out into four independent 25GBASE‑CU channels. Ideal for 100G‑to‑4×25G port expansion for leaf‑spine fabrics, switch‑to‑switch and switch‑to‑server interconnections.
-
Passive Zero‑Power Copper Architecture
No internal signal‑amplifier chips. Operates at zero power consumption, reduces data‑center power budget and thermal load, ensures stable signal integrity for short‑to‑medium‑reach 100G/25G high‑speed transmission.
-
Ultra‑Low‑Latency Interconnection
Twinax copper direct‑attach design provides minimal signal latency compared with active optical cables, suitable for low‑latency data‑center, virtualization and AI‑cluster environments.
-
Hot‑Swappable QSFP28 and SFP28 Interfaces
Standard hot‑pluggable QSFP28 host connector and four SFP28 fan‑out connectors. Technicians can insert or remove the cable without powering down connected Cisco switches, routers and servers.
-
Multi‑Layer Shielded Twinax Construction
High‑quality multi‑layer shielded twinax copper cable suppresses EMI and RFI electromagnetic interference, lowers crosstalk risk under high‑density rack deployment conditions.
-
Standard Pull‑Tab Latch Design
Equipped with pull‑tab latches on QSFP28 and each SFP28 connector for convenient insertion and extraction from network hardware ports.
Technical Specifications
-
Part Number: QSFP‑4SFP25G‑CU3M
-
Cable Length: 3 m (9.84 ft)
-
Cable Type: Passive Shielded Twinax Copper Breakout Assembly
-
Interface: One QSFP28 to Four SFP28
-
Data Rate: Aggregate 100 Gbps (4 × 25 Gbps full‑duplex per channel)
-
Standards Compliance: SFF‑8665, SFF‑8402, IEEE 802.3bj
-
Typical Power Consumption: 0 W (Passive)
-
Commercial Operating Temperature: 0°C ~ 70°C
-
Storage Temperature: ‑40°C ~ 85°C
-
Outer Jacket: Black PVC
-
Environmental Compliance: RoHS‑6 Lead‑Free
Compatible Hardware
Cisco switches and routers equipped with QSFP28 100G ports supporting breakout function, including Cisco Nexus series, Catalyst 9000X series data‑center switches, aggregation switches, and other third‑party network devices complying with QSFP28 / SFP28 MSA specifications supporting passive breakout direct‑attach copper cablesCisco.
Application Scenarios
Designed for short‑to‑medium‑distance intra‑rack and adjacent cross‑rack interconnections in cloud data centers, enterprise data centers, AI and HPC environments. Typical use cases include 100G‑to‑4×25G port expansion, leaf‑spine switch interconnections, switch‑to‑server links and short‑to‑medium‑reach Storage Area Network (SAN) connections, where zero‑power, low‑latency and cost‑effective copper breakout interconnection is preferred.
